    Windows Firewall as Network Firewall

    Although initially criticised as being weak the Windows Firewall has improved with each build and is perfectly suited to protect ITS HOST.

    However to use it as a network firewall service would not be its intended use and lacks many features common to dedicated firewall appliances. It lacks Stateful packet inspection common to even the most basic domestic router and its exception management
    is built around the applications installed on the host, something not possible if the applications are on remote devices on the corporate network.

    As I have said the firewall incorporated in domestic ADSL/VDSL/DSL routers is more appropriate so it really depends on what your inbound connection service is. Alternatively there are a number of free firewall distros built on the Linux platform and do not
    need particularly powerful hardware to run on (in fact add nothing to the performance at all).

    Free Firewall for Home Users | Free Home Security Appliance Download | Sophos XG Firewall

    Otherwise spend the money you would have on the "high performance" system on a dedicated device such as from SonicWALL et a. Surprisingly the cheapest dedicated firewall on Newegg is from Cisco is only $62 although this is not a recommendation. As you say
    a Firewall is very important, worth spending at least some money on it.
